Description
Set behind a charming stone wall in the heart of Birkhill, 2 Dronley Road offers a generous and versatile home that’s as welcoming as its peaceful, tree-lined surroundings. With its detached layout, gated driveway, and detached garage, this property combines privacy and practicality, all within a short stroll of local amenities, scenic woodland walks and Birkhill Primary School.
Inside, the home opens up beautifully. The dual-aspect lounge is a standout—flooded with natural light from a deep bay window and framed with warm timber accents, it’s a spacious room perfect for both relaxing evenings and entertaining friends. French doors lead through to the dining room, creating a natural flow that’s ideal for gatherings, while the adjoining kitchen offers ample storage, sleek worktops, and a lovely view across the rear garden. There’s also a separate utility room, tucked discreetly out of sight for everyday convenience.
With four well-proportioned bedrooms, three upstairs and one on the ground floor- the layout lends itself easily to a range of lifestyles. Whether you need space for family, guests, or a dedicated home office, there’s room to adapt. The principal bedroom upstairs enjoys built-in mirrored wardrobes and a peaceful, leafy outlook, while the ground-floor bedroom offers easy accessibility and sits just steps from the spacious main bathroom, complete with corner bath and separate shower enclosure.
Step outside and the garden reveals itself as a low-maintenance retreat. Thoughtfully landscaped with gravel pathways, established planting, and a sheltered seating area beneath a wooden pergola. It’s a lovely spot to enjoy a morning coffee or catch the evening sun, with plenty of privacy and a detached garage for added storage or workshop potential.
